Picking the Wrong Paint Shade



Picking the ideal paint shade is a critical choice when painting your insides, as it sets the tone and atmosphere of the space. One usual error to avoid is choosing the wrong paint color. The color you choose can substantially impact the general feel and look of a room.

For instance, going with dark colors in a tiny space can make it feel confined and dismal, while selecting excessively bright colors may result in a space that feels overwhelming and distracting.

To avoid this error, think about variables such as the area's all-natural light, the feature of the space, and the mood you wish to create. It's additionally important to check paint samples on the walls before dedicating to a color to see how it looks in different lights problems throughout the day.

Seeking advice from expert painters or indoor designers can likewise aid you make a notified choice and guarantee that the selected paint shade boosts the looks of your space.

Neglecting Appropriate Surface Area Prep Work



When painting your insides, neglecting correct surface area preparation can lead to unacceptable results and reduce the long life of the paint job. Among one of the most critical action in accomplishing a professional-looking surface is guaranteeing that the surfaces to be repainted are tidy, smooth, and effectively primed.

Disregarding to cleanse the wall surfaces thoroughly prior to paint can lead to adhesion issues, where the paint falls short to properly adhere to the surface area. Dust, dust, and oil can avoid the paint from sticking evenly, causing peeling or flaking in time.

Effectively topping the surfaces prior to painting is also vital, as it aids the paint adhere better, promotes also protection, and can prevent spots or staining from hemorrhaging through.

Taking the time to prepare the surfaces properly will eventually make sure a professional and long-lasting paint task.

Rushing Through the Painting Refine



Quickly advancing through the painting procedure can jeopardize the top quality and sturdiness of the final result. Hurrying can cause a number of issues, such as irregular coverage, noticeable brush strokes, repaint drips, and missed out on spots. Each of these issues diminishes the overall visual appeal of the area and can be lengthy to deal with.



When painting, it's crucial to allow adequate time for every coat to dry prior to using the following one.
